tike
Plural: tikes
Noun
- A small child, often mischievous; a dog.
- a crude uncouth ill-bred person lacking culture or refinement
- a young person of either sex
- Alternative spelling of tyke (mongrel dog)
- Alternative spelling of tyke (Yorkshireman)
- A boorish person.
- Archaic form of tick (type of arthropod).
